For Iranian-American photographer Ashkan Sahihi, New York City in the 1980s epitomized refuge and protection, progress and opportunity. But the community was soon shaken by HIV and AIDS, and numerous friends and colleagues from the art scene lost their lives. In the 2010s in Berlin, it appeared to Sahihi that Berlin had replaced New York as a place of longing. Sahihi's conceptual series is an homage to friends of days past and a plea for the privilege of living a life in freedom and openness, as well as for tolerance and a sense of belonging.
